1. AI in Production Processes
1.1 Automated Bottling Systems
AI-powered automated bottling systems optimize the filling process. These systems utilize machine learning algorithms to analyze real-time data from sensors monitoring bottle fill levels, ensuring precise measurements. This reduces waste and enhances operational efficiency, allowing La Fantana to meet high demand without compromising quality.
1.2 Predictive Maintenance
AI-driven predictive maintenance models utilize historical data from machinery to predict potential failures before they occur. By analyzing patterns in equipment performance, La Fantana can schedule maintenance proactively, minimizing downtime and reducing repair costs. This approach not only extends the lifespan of machinery but also ensures consistent production levels.
1.3 Process Optimization
Machine learning algorithms can analyze data from various stages of production, identifying bottlenecks and inefficiencies. By implementing AI-based process optimization, La Fantana can streamline workflows, reduce energy consumption, and enhance overall productivity. For instance, adjusting operational parameters in real time based on demand forecasts can lead to significant cost savings.
2. AI in Distribution Logistics
2.1 Demand Forecasting
AI algorithms can analyze historical sales data, seasonal trends, and external factors (such as weather patterns) to forecast demand accurately. For La Fantana, this capability ensures that inventory levels are optimized, reducing both surplus and stockouts. Improved demand forecasting allows for better resource allocation and inventory management.
2.2 Route Optimization
AI-driven route optimization tools analyze traffic patterns, delivery schedules, and geographic data to determine the most efficient delivery routes. For La Fantana, optimizing delivery routes not only reduces transportation costs but also minimizes environmental impact by lowering fuel consumption. This is particularly crucial in an industry focused on sustainability.
2.3 Fleet Management
Integrating AI into fleet management systems can enhance operational efficiency. Real-time tracking of delivery vehicles, coupled with AI analytics, provides insights into driver performance, vehicle health, and fuel usage. This data enables La Fantana to make informed decisions about fleet operations, ensuring timely deliveries and reducing costs.
3. AI in Quality Control
3.1 Real-time Quality Monitoring
AI technologies can be integrated into quality control systems to monitor parameters such as water purity, mineral content, and contamination levels in real time. Utilizing sensors and AI algorithms, La Fantana can ensure that every bottle meets stringent quality standards, thereby maintaining consumer trust and regulatory compliance.
3.2 Anomaly Detection
Machine learning models can be trained to recognize patterns associated with high-quality production. By employing anomaly detection algorithms, La Fantana can swiftly identify deviations from standard quality metrics, enabling immediate corrective actions. This proactive approach significantly reduces the risk of product recalls and enhances brand reputation.
